bald |
having little or no hair on the head. |
dock1 |
a raised, flat surface that is built out into the water. |
driver |
a person who drives, or a person whose job is to drive. |
exit |
a way out. |
fetch |
to go somewhere, pick up something, and bring it back. |
flesh |
the soft parts of the human or animal body that lie between the skin and the bones. Flesh includes muscle and fat. |
flight |
a trip on a plane from one place to another. |
full |
holding as much as possible. |
motorcycle |
a vehicle with two wheels, a heavy frame, and an engine. |
needle |
a thin tool made of steel with a hole at one end and a sharp point at the other end. You put thread through the hole. Needles are used for sewing. |
punishment |
a way of causing someone to suffer or experience something bad for having done something wrong. |
trailer |
a wagon pulled by a car or truck and used to carry a load. |
tube |
a long, hollow piece of glass, metal, or rubber used to hold or carry liquids or gases. |
type |
a group of things that are the same in some way. |
wage |
(often plural) money paid at regular times to a person for doing work. |
